Output e32d60b7b02608f3de6bf203f39a3dc2dd82714a303169bfe4e2333b351f9f28:0

value
860071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19b98d93b814bd8c5063b4375dd23b23efda784f OP_EQUAL
address
34336noEvUEw3qcPGyYG8sieaXP5f6s1nE
transaction
e32d60b7b02608f3de6bf203f39a3dc2dd82714a303169bfe4e2333b351f9f28
spent
true